揭秘Web服务器:网站背后的强大支撑
web服务器是什么

首页 2024-09-26 01:58:56



深入理解Web服务器:构建互联网世界的基石 在当今这个数字化时代,互联网已成为连接全球、推动社会进步与经济发展的重要力量

    而在这庞大的网络体系中,Web服务器无疑扮演着举足轻重的角色,它们是支撑起整个互联网世界的基石,承载着数据的传输、存储与呈现,使得信息能够跨越千山万水,瞬间触达每一个角落

    本文将深入探讨Web服务器的定义、功能、类型、关键技术以及其在现代互联网生态中的重要性

     Web服务器的定义 简而言之,Web服务器是互联网上的一个软件程序,专门设计用于处理来自客户端(如网页浏览器)的请求,并返回相应的响应

    这些请求通常是对存储在服务器上的网页、图像、视频、数据库查询结果等资源的访问请求

    Web服务器通过HTTP(超文本传输协议)或HTTPS(安全的超文本传输协议)等协议与客户端进行通信,确保数据的正确传输与接收

     功能与角色 1.资源托管:Web服务器最基础的功能是托管网站和应用程序所需的文件和数据

    这包括但不限于HTML文档、CSS样式表、JavaScript脚本、图片、视频等多媒体内容

     2.请求处理:当客户端(如用户浏览器)发送请求时,Web服务器会解析这些请求,定位到请求的资源,并将资源内容打包发送给客户端

     3.动态内容生成:除了静态内容外,现代Web服务器还常与后端应用程序服务器协作,处理复杂的逻辑运算和数据库查询,动态生成网页内容,如用户个性化页面、搜索结果等

     4.安全管理:Web服务器负责实施一系列安全措施,如身份验证、访问控制、数据加密等,以保护服务器上的资源不被未经授权的访问或篡改

     5.性能优化:通过负载均衡、缓存机制、压缩算法等技术手段,Web服务器能够提升网站访问速度,优化用户体验,降低运营成本

     类型概览 Web服务器根据其功能和部署方式可分为多种类型: - Apache HTTP Server:作为最流行的开源Web服务器之一,Apache以其高可靠性、强大的扩展性和

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密